Andy Murray's US Open continues against Stanislas Wawrinka on Louis Armstrong and he is soon in discussions with umpire Steve Ullrich. The winner will play American Sam Querrey in the fourth round
The world number four spills blood and shouts with frustration as he sees a second set tie-break slip away
Wawrinka calls for the trainer for treatment on his right thigh and left quad, but looks the stronger of the two players as he seals the third set
A strangely lethargic Murray takes his turn in the hands of the trainer, but it does not help re-energise his game as he continues to look badly out of sorts
The Scot, who was composed and calm on his way to victory in the Rogers Cup in Toronto in August, seems at war with the world as he fails to raise his game
Wawrinka, who lost in five sets to Murray under the Centre Court roof at Wimbledon last year, takes the crowd's applause as he sees out a 6-7 (3-7) 7-6 (7-4) 6-3 6-3 win
By contrast it is a disconsolate trudge back to the dressing room for the British number one who sees another season go by without a maiden Grand Slam win
Serbia's world number 40 Ana Ivanovic has been in good nick at Flushing Meadows, but her run comes to a miserable end in the third round. The 22-year-old plays OK for 20 minutes but then is blown off the Arthur Ashe court
Belgium's second seed Kim Clijsters looks invincible as the defending champ beats Ivanovic 6-2 6-1. It's the 18th match she's won in a row at Flushing Meadows. Can anybody stop the Clijsters train?
One lady who could give Clijsters a run for her money is Italian sixth seed Francesca Schiavone. Her grunts are second to none but there's no questioning her form as she sweeps Anastasia Pavlyuchenkova aside 6-3 6-0

Venus Williams has reached the last eight in nine of her previous 11 appearances at Flushing Meadows and is through to the quarter-finals again after a 7-6 (7-3) 6-3 win over Shahar Peer of Israel
The third seed progresses after a testing first set that lasts over an hour and features six break points against the two-time champion
Williams will face Italy's Francesca Schiavone in the quarter-finals with the possibility of a semi-final against defending champion Kim Clijsters up for grabs

John Isner is soon behind in his match against Russia's Mikhail Youzhny as the American fails to regain an early break in the first set
But Isner's monstrous serve helps him engineer a way back into the match as the six foot nine inch 25-year-old draws level with a 9-7 win in the second-set tie-break
By the end of the match, it is Youzhny's trademark celebration that the Arthur Ashe crowd are treated to as he secures a 6-4 6-7 (7-9) 7-6 (7-5) 6-4 win
Australian fifth seed Samantha Stosur takes the first set of her match against Elena Dementieva as the pair battle for the chance to take on Kim Clijsters in the quarters
Dementieva dominates the middle part of the match and seems able to break Stosur's serve at will, but her composure deserts her in an extraordinary finale
After surviving four match points against her, Stosur clinches a 6-3 2-6 7-6 (7-2) win as the clock ticks past 0130 local time
